Resident Evil Code: Veronica, released in Japan as Biohazard Code: Veronica, is the fourth game in Capcom's Resident Evil survival horror series, originally released for the Sega Dreamcast in 2000. It is notable for being the first Resident Evil title to debut on a non-Sony platform, in contrast to the first three installments, which were originally PlayStation games and then ported to other platforms.
Problems
Missing Video
"New game" film is missing.
Unplayed Sounds
Some sounds are missing.
Missing Textures
All background textures are missing (textures visible only on characters and some objects).
Crash
New game problem (shut down Dolphin) can't be played on Mac.
Configuration
No configuration changes are known to affect compatibility for this title.
